hi i installed broadwave but if any of my friend want to listen from another computer they can not listen to it

i have verizon dsl and i have actiontec gt704wg modem i opened port on my modem like this where it says

port start i entered 88 port end 88 port map 88 i also tried 85 instead of 88 in all three fields but is still not working

 

let us say if my ip address is 122.168.12.1 what do my friend need to type in the internet explorer address bar exactly to connect to broadwave on my computer and also which ip address should i use incomin or outgoing and how do find them.

and also do i need to get a website to start my radio or is there any other way that i can use my computer as server

or anything like that please explain in detail i will be very thankful to you.

The address for anyone on the internet to listen should be similar to the below

 

http://your IP address here:88/broadwave.asx?src=1

 

Replace "your IP address here" with your current IP address which you can find out at http://www.ipaddy.com/ also if you are connected through a router make sure you have enabled it for Port forwarding otherwise it wont work.

Sorry just to say that adress is for when you are forwarding through port 88 if you are using a diff port just change the 88 in the address to 85 or which ever port you are using
